On Fri, Aug 31, 2007 at 12:02:41PM -0200, Alberto Monteiro wrote:
> Tentar atualizar o sistema pelo yum (e não pelo CD) deve ter
> deixado o seu sistema com os pacotes todos bagunçados.
>
Eu tentei atualizar pelo yum há umas 4 semanas, mas não deu certo,
e eu continuei usando o FC4 normalmente. Aliás, eu só resolvi
trocar FC4 -> FC6 porque caí no canto da sereia que dava para
acessar uma droga de celular com Linux :-/
Mesmo usando o CD, não sei se atualização FC4->FC6 direto, sem passar
pelo FC5 deveria funcionar.
Agora, imagina uma atualização FC4->FC6 direto, depois de ter feito
uma meia-atualização usando o yum que deixou o sistema com cara de
mutante. Seria milagre se tivesse funcionado direito. :)
======
Nota adicionada depois de ter escrito as instruções ali embaixo:
Ainda assim, depois de todo esse trabalho, o 'yum upgrade' pode não
deixar tudo configurado e funcionando direitinho. Será que não fica
mais fácil você fazer um backup do seu /home (e do /etc para caso
queira olhar como estavam as configurações antigas), e instalar o
FC6 do zero? Acho que nem eu, que trabalho com empacotamento de RPM
todo dia, teria paciência para ficar resolvendo os problemas do sistema
meio-atualizado, se levasse mais de 2 horas de trabalho.
=======
> Você pode conseguir atualizar o kernel, mas e o monte de pacotes
> que pode ter ficado sem atualizar, além do kernel? Vai ficar
> pra sempre caçando dependência manualmente?
> O yum ainda é seu amigo. :)
>
Quando funciona, né? No FC4, já não funcionava mais.
No FC4 já não funcionava? Isso é um problema.
Eu já tentei algo parecido: desabilitei todos repositórios não-oficiais,
fiz yum update, e tive o dissabor de receber mensagem de erro no final
do yum update - por causa de pacotes que não existem.
Manda as mensagens de erro do 'yum upgrade', quem sabe a gente tem
sugestões.
Só para garantir, qual a saída de:
- rpm -q fedora-release
- rpm -V fedora-release
O seu yum está todo apontando para repositórios do FC6, certo?
Eu ainda não comecei a fazer yum remove *.*; mas isso resolveria
o problema, ou deixaria o sistema ainda mais capenga?
Aí seria loucura. :)
O básico seria:
- 'yum update nome-do-pacote' ou 'yum install nome-do-pacote' de pacotes
que o yum não tá conseguindo atualizar sozinho
- 'yum remove nome-do-pacote' de pacotes que você não queira instalar
e estejam causando problemas na hora do upgrade.
**** Nessa parte tome cuidado para não remover pacotes essenciais, como
mencionei antes *****.
Se você estiver sem os repositórios não-oficiais, você pode precisar
remover quase todos os pacotes dos repositórios não oficiais, para
o upgrade funcionar. Você escolhe se quer tentar fazer o upgrade
incluindo os pacotes não oficiais (sem remover os repositórios não
oficiais), ou remover os pacotes não oficiais para instalar de novo
no final do upgrade.
--
Eduardo